On this unique journey, you'll follow in the footsteps of the brave souls that existed during the era of the Underground Railroad. Typically, the itinerary for the tour spans about 1.5 miles and takes approximately 2 hours to complete. As the tour requires a fair bit of walking, comfortable shoes and weather-appropriate clothing are recommended. The guide, an expert on the history of the area, will illuminate your path with stories from the past, making each landmark you encounter a point of interest.
Passing through historic Old Town Alexandria, you'll stop by key landmarks that played an essential role in the Underground Railroad. These include places like the Franklin and Armfield Office, one of the largest slave-trading companies in the country. You'll get to explore the profound narratives that took place within the cobbled streets, coming face to face with the impact and the legacy of slavery in the district.
